Skip to content

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
    • Help
    • Support
    • Submit feedback
  • Sign in
Project Templates
Project Templates
  • Project overview
    • Project overview
    • Details
    • Activity
    • Releases
    • Cycle Analytics
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
    • Charts
  • Issues 0
    • Issues 0
    • List
    • Boards
    • Labels
    • Milestones
  • Merge Requests 3
    • Merge Requests 3
  • CI / CD
    • CI / CD
    • Pipelines
    • Jobs
    • Schedules
    • Charts
  • Packages
    • Packages
    • Container Registry
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Members
    • Members
  • Collapse sidebar
  • Activity
  • Graph
  • Charts
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
  • DevOps
  • Project TemplatesProject Templates
  • Merge Requests
  • !90

Merged
Opened Jul 22, 2019 by Richard Crosby@richard.crosby3 of 3 tasks completed3/3 tasks
  • Report abuse
Report abuse

chore(deployment): update to use new deployment module

Description

Updates the CI deployment steps to use the latest Terraform deployment module: https://git.brickblock.sh/devops/tf-deploy/merge_requests/3

This MR also forces the deployments to use a specific version of our deployment module. This should ensure that changes versioned changes to that deployment module won't unexpectedly breake project deployments.

What it should look like

Add screenshots, invision links, or animated GIFs showing the new feature in action

Related issues

  • https://git.brickblock.sh/devops/tf-deploy/merge_requests/3

Done

  • Update review deployment stage
  • Update staging deployment stage
  • Update production deployment stage

How to test

As these are GitLab CI changes, this MR cannot be tested directly. Instead, I'd recommend testing this MR.

Edited Jul 22, 2019 by Richard Crosby
  • Discussion 4
  • Commits 4
  • Pipelines 9
  • Changes 3
Assignee
Assign to
None
Milestone
None
Assign milestone
Time tracking
0
Labels
None
Assign labels
  • View project labels
Reference: devops/project-templates!90